Port Dickson Beach
Port Dickson has the longest beaches in Malaysia, as far as 18 km, it includes public beaches and beaches own by private sector that operate Hotel and Resorts. Not all beaches is suitable for bathing or swimming, this due of the appearance of the beach terrain and the quality of sea water. However, visitors have many options to choose according to their activity.

Getting To Port Dickson
-
KTM Komuter - Take KTM Kommuter from any station in Kuala Lumpur to Seremban station, from Seremban bus station located about 10 minutes walking, take a cityliner bus to Port Dickson bus station, bus fare should be RM4.00 or take a cab RM40 one way or RM100 for daily use from Seremban bus station.
-
Driving - use Plus highway towards to Seremban, just follow the signboard to new Port Dickson highway.
